Webannual salary is £34,304 (from 1/08/21) basic weekly rate is £34,304 ÷ 52.18 weeks = £657.42. basic hourly rate is £657.42 ÷ 37 hours per week = £17.77. (this may need to be reduced to reflect the actual working week at the institution in question; however, we would not expect a working week in excess of 37 hours) comprehensive hourly ...

WebOvertime pay of $15 × 5 hours × 1.5 (OT rate) = $112.50. Wage for the day $120 + $112.50 = $232.50. Don't forget that this is the minimum figure, as laid down by law. An employer may choose a higher rate of overtime pay. Some companies pay 2.5 times the standard rate for overtime and sometimes even more. WebMay 4, 2024 · Teacher A is an experienced middle leader and earns £45,000 a year. If they stick to the 1,265 hours, their hourly pay is £35.57 per hour. If they work a 56-hour week, then this drops to £20.64 an hour.
